查找 Android 设备序列号(SN码)的方法

在 Android 开发中,获取设备的序列号(SN码)可能是一个常见的需求。这篇文章将逐步指导你如何查找 Android 设备的 SN码。我们将使用表格和代码示例来帮助你更好地理解这个过程。

主要步骤流程

以下是查找 Android 设备 SN 码的流程:

步骤 描述
1 配置 Android Studio 环境
2 创建新项目
3 编写代码获取序列号
4 运行应用并查看输出

步骤详解

1. 配置 Android Studio 环境

首先确保你已经安装了 Android Studio,并配置好 JDK 和 SDK。可以参考以下步骤:

  • 下载并安装 Android Studio。
  • 启动 IDE,并设置 SDK 路径。

2. 创建新项目

  • 打开 Android Studio。
  • 点击 "New Project"。
  • 选择 "Empty Activity",然后点击 "Next"。
  • 填写项目名称(如 "GetSNCode"),选择 "Kotlin" 作为编程语言。
  • 点击 "Finish" 创建项目。

3. 编写代码获取序列号

打开 MainActivity.kt 文件,并添加以下代码:

package com.example.getsncode

import androidx.appcompat.app.AppCompatActivity
import android.os.Bundle
import android.widget.TextView

class MainActivity : AppCompatActivity() {

    override fun onCreate(savedInstanceState: Bundle?) {
        super.onCreate(savedInstanceState)
        setContentView(R.layout.activity_main)

        // 获取设备的序列号
        val serialNumber: String = android.os.Build.SERIAL

        // 找到 TextView,并显示序列号
        val serialTextView: TextView = findViewById(R.id.serialTextView)
        serialTextView.text = "设备序列号: $serialNumber" // 显示设备的序列号
    }
}

代码解释:

  • android.os.Build.SERIAL:这个属性用于获取设备的序列号。
  • findViewById(R.id.serialTextView):找到布局中的 TextView 控件,确保你在布局文件中定义了这个 TextView。

4. 运行应用并查看输出

确保你已经连接了 Android 设备或启动了模拟器。执行以下操作:

  • 点击 “Run” 按钮。
  • 查看设备上的输出结果,应该会在 TextView 中看到你的设备序列号。

甘特图

接下来,我们可以使用甘特图来可视化这个流程。以下是用 Mermaid 语法表示的甘特图:

gantt
    title 查找 Android 设备序列号流程
    dateFormat  YYYY-MM-DD
    section 配置环境
    配置 Android Studio    :a1, 2023-10-01, 1d
    section 创建项目
    创建新项目            :a2, 2023-10-02, 1d
    section 编写代码
    编写获取序列号代码     :a3, 2023-10-03, 2d
    section 运行应用
    运行并查看输出        :a4, 2023-10-05, 1d

总结

通过上述步骤,你现在应该能够成功获取 Android 设备的 SN 码,并显示在应用的界面上。这是了解 Android 开发和设备信息的一个基础环节。在日后的开发中,获取设备信息可能会对你了解设备状态或调试问题有所帮助。如果你有任何疑问,或者需要进一步的帮助,请随时咨询。我期待看到你在 Android 开发方面的成长与进步!